What companies run services between Bournemouth, England and Legoland Windsor, England?

Cross Country operates a train from Bournemouth to Reading hourly. Tickets cost £19–60 and the journey takes 1h 22m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bournemouth Station to Legoland Windsor via Heathrow Terminal 5 and Legoland Staff Entrance and Park & Ride in around 3h 3m.
